WebDec 15, 2024 · The Greenbrier River has 13 primitive campsites along the trail which typically include picnic tables, a tent platform and/or shelter, filtered water via hand-pump, trash cans, and outhouses. We spent our first night at MP 63.8 (mile post) and our second night at MP 69.6. The tent platform was occupied at the first site so we pitched our tent ...

WebApr 10, 2024 · If you’re looking for a scenic adventure in West Virginia, the Greenbrier River Trail is a must-visit state park. This 77.1-mile rail trail runs from North Caldwell to Cass, offering remarkable views of the state’s eastern landscape.
